smallbird 发表于 2011-11-13 15:50:24

买了块显示屏,求MSP430的驱动代码?

前几天买了块2.4寸显示屏,用51成功点亮了。
求msp430f149的代码,哪位好人给一个完整的啊。
我的屏驱动是9325的。

nongxiaoming 发表于 2011-11-13 15:51:38

晕哦,51都驱动了,就改一下子就可以用MSP430了啊

jlhgold 发表于 2011-11-13 16:43:52

顶LS 如果连这都不会改 LZ放弃吧

proteldxp 发表于 2011-11-13 19:14:54

我刚改好了F5438的程序你要不?有问题和我讨论,我也刚学430.qq:364657785
点击此处下载 ourdev_694853PL5ALV.zip(文件大小:23K) (原文件名:ex5.zip)

not_at_all 发表于 2011-11-13 20:05:43

这样简单的问题都不能自己解决,建议不要学单片机了。

kingwaykingway 发表于 2011-11-14 11:50:41

可以用彩屏模块

smallbird 发表于 2011-11-14 11:57:25

回复【4楼】not_at_all
这样简单的问题都不能自己解决,建议不要学单片机了。
-----------------------------------------------------------------------
偶是新人,不要打击偶好不好。

smallbird 发表于 2011-11-14 21:42:21

回复【3楼】proteldxp
我刚改好了f5438的程序你要不?有问题和我讨论,我也刚学430.qq:364657785
点击此处下载
-----------------------------------------------------------------------

多谢了,有空来请教你,这几天忙

not_at_all 发表于 2011-11-15 18:50:38

回复【6楼】smallbird
回复【4楼】not_at_all
这样简单的问题都不能自己解决,建议不要学单片机了。
-----------------------------------------------------------------------
偶是新人,不要打击偶好不好。
-----------------------------------------------------------------------
我打击的不是你的能力,而是你的学习方法或者态度。
假如你不是我所说那种人,我向你道歉。因为现在有许多学单片机的都这样,太依赖“例程”,一旦搞不懂不是想着怎样解决,而是想着怎样找现有的例子或者问人,这样的话,你好像学会了,但是你的能力并没有提高过,你仅仅知道多一个常识罢了,以后遇到类似问题你还是转不过弯。寻找帮助是最后的选择。能够独立解决自己认为不能解决的问题,这才是真正的能力。

假如你有上进心的(各人学习目的不同,我不做强求),你可以做一个测试:找一条你认为有一点难度,但是自认为已经掌握了的程序,自己重新写一遍并且完成调试,在这过程中,程序中每一个字母都用手敲进去,不得粘贴复制,不能接触任何相关资料(datasheet例外,但不能看程序范例),无论你成功或者失败,你都会有体会。
到时候你就知道我是否该向你道歉。假如我说错了,你在心里骂我就行。技术才是要讨论的内容。

smallbird 发表于 2011-11-15 19:32:59

回复【8楼】not_at_all
回复【6楼】smallbird
回复【4楼】not_at_all   
这样简单的问题都不能自己解决,建议不要学单片机了。
-----------------------------------------------------------------------
偶是新人,不要打击偶好不好。
-----------------------------------------------------------------------
我打击的不是你的能力,而是你的学习方法或者态度。
假如你不是我所说那种人,我向你道歉。因为现在有许多学单片机的都这样,太依赖“例程”,一旦搞不懂不是想着怎样解决,而是想着怎样找现有的例子或者问人,这样的话,你好像学会了,但是你的能力并没有提高过,你仅仅知道多一个常识罢了,以后遇到类似问题你还是转不过弯。寻找帮助是最后的选择。能够独立解决自......
-----------------------------------------------------------------------

呵呵不要当真。
开玩笑的,那个TFT对新人来说的确太难了。自己编很难整出来。我没有合适的仿真器的。

not_at_all 发表于 2011-11-15 20:59:00

TFT难点在于初始化的参数,一旦知道初始化的参数,就剩下IO口驱动,而你用51成功点亮,就说明IO驱动时序方面已经有成功案例,你移植到msp430f149,只是改一下IO驱动相关的程序,对于初学的,即使比较简单,也许会有点胆怯,但这是必经阶段。这一部跨不出去,不要指望技术水平会得到提高。

例如你现在驱动液晶屏,可以模仿51的方式写驱动,51的是用IO口模拟总线时序的吧,你用同样的方式用msp430f149写驱动,
已经确认初始化参数是正确的,如果得不到预期结果,不是电平问题就是时序问题,可以自己慢慢排除各种可能性(我自己也解决过这些问题,绝对不是想当然地说话)。不一定需要仿真器的。假如没有仿真器,而需要监视某些内存数据,可以只程序中间插入串口程序输到电脑,用串口监控软件看。

问题只有一个,但是解决的方法不止一个。

smallbird 发表于 2011-11-16 11:23:02

参考老乡的代码,搞定了,谢谢老乡
http://cache.amobbs.com/bbs_upload782111/files_47/ourdev_695711XXANGN.JPG
(原文件名:100_0747.JPG)

http://cache.amobbs.com/bbs_upload782111/files_47/ourdev_695712KHFCG0.JPG
(原文件名:100_0748.JPG)

ywb888 发表于 2011-11-22 09:29:04

同求,我也有一块这样的屏

duandiyinfen 发表于 2011-11-27 00:59:02

在做学校竞赛的时候,我们组负责写程序的同学的一个无线收发的程序,显示用51自己写出来,当然参照了买模块的技术资料,之后他改到飞思卡尔的XS128上,嵌入式ARM7上还有MSP430F2618上,写了一回,改了3回,他现在对那块很熟悉,我只是想劝LZ,尽量自己改一改,那样收获会大一点!

lping349 发表于 2012-1-10 13:54:09

3楼11楼的朋友,请问什么型号屏几寸,什么驱动?./emotion/em045.gif

xcy20127548 发表于 2012-1-12 16:44:51

楼主的程序结构好的话,稍微改改define 的就行了啊

xiousi 发表于 2012-2-15 12:40:54

你用51都点亮了,也没把显示屏的使用掌握起来?或只是MSP430还不会用?
页: [1]
查看完整版本: 买了块显示屏,求MSP430的驱动代码?